How to password protect a Polymorphic VI

Sir/madam,
              I am working in a project which seems to have some polymorphic VI.So i need to password protect the polymorphic Vi .I need to know how to protect it.

Open the VI and go to File>>VI Properties>>Security.
If you want to protect the actual VIs you will need to do this to every one of them.

  • How to password protect a numbers document

    I'm trying to figure out how to password protect a numbers document.
    My intention is to load this document onto a website, but only want authorized persons with the correct password to be able to access.
    Any ideas??
    Thanks

    bscaplan wrote:
    I am using Numbers 08
    And the Numbers User Guide, supplied with iWork '08, make no mention of password protection, which was introduced in Numbers '09.
    Looks like the best option is Wayne's second suggestion—open via File > Print > PDF > Open in Preview, then Save the resulting PDF document with encryption turned on.
    An alternate, if you want the recipients to receive a copy of the Numbers '08 file, and to be able to edit that file, you could enclose it in a secure disk image file.
    The basic procedure is to:
    Use Disk Utility to create a new, blank, sparse disk image, assign a password and save.
    Double-click the .dmg file (and enter the password when requested) to mount the disk image on your desktop, then Save a copy of your file to the (open) disk image.
    When done, eject the image, and upload the (encrypted) .dmg file to the website.
    Detailed instructions may be found in Disk Utility's Help files.
    Launch DU (found in the Utilities folder in Applications), click the Help menu and choose Disk Utility help.
    Go to the index, scroll to and click Security, then click a title similar to "Protecting confidential documents in a secure disk image." (a search on 'confidential' should also take you to a list containing that title.)
    My version of DU is old enough that sparse images hadn't been introduced, or I'd post a copy of the article here.

  • How to password protect sensitive info

    Hey all,
    I have an Imac that is shared by the family. Occasionally, the kids move or delete things that I need for work.
    Can anyone help me with how to password protect specific folders so that the Imac is open to use but some files can not be accessed without a password.
    I would settle for a "hiding" program so they can't delete what they can't see.
    Thanks
    ontap

    You can use Disk Utility to create encrypted disk images of your secret folders (menu File > New), also encrypted sparse images that can grow as you add more data to it.
    But the different User Accounts for each member of family is by far the most friendly and natural solution IMO.

  • How to password protect macmail?

    How can I password protect my email account, MacMail?

    Password protect the Mac Mail app is useless,and would not prevent access to your mailboxes.Your email is stored in files under your home folder,so you must password your mail folder.

  • How to Password Protect a Directory so all Files are Protected?

    Hello CFers and Happy Holidays,
    I am moving a web site over from a Linux server over to a
    Windows 2000 server. The site was currently password protected via
    the oh so familiar .htaccess method on the Linux server. Now that
    the site is on IIS on Windows, the .htaccess files don't work.
    I have created a MSSQL database with a users table that
    contains all of the username and passwords that are allowed to
    access the site.
    Normally I would just log users in by querying the database,
    setting a session variable, and then using application.cfm to check
    to make sure the users is logged in. However, in this particualr
    site, most of the files are made up of .htm files which do not get
    processed by the ColdFusion application.cfm tag.
    Several posts indicated that I would need to disable
    anonymous access within IIS and then create the individual user
    accounts within Administrative Tools > Computer Management >
    Users and Groups. However, in this case, I don't want to create
    thousands of new users within windows.
    Is there a way for me to password protect all files within a
    directory while still using the accounts set up in my MSSQL
    database for authentication?
    Thanks,
    David Levin

    > Several posts indicated that I would need to disable
    anonymous access within
    > IIS and then create the individual user accounts within
    Administrative Tools >
    > Computer Management > Users and Groups. However, in
    this case, I don't want to
    > create thousands of new users within windows.
    How many users did you have in your .htaccess config? That's
    how many
    you'd need to set up in IIS. With IIS & file system
    permissions you're
    effecting the same thing you would with Apache's .htaccess
    authorisation.
    Except using GUI tools rather than text files; it's the same
    principle,
    though.
    Or... you could just install Apache and use that instead,
    sticking with the
    approach you're used to.
